Output 89902ec4f68b0034cd4410d9eadec2321da113aecdf0f8454af053f5f8bf7140:0

value
510153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e5dbdcc135e74598679ab986b312233f36f41e3 OP_EQUALVERIFY OP_CHECKSIG
address
1DymFWN17RXQXSpAtNEBCh3a3VkWV9T2zh
transaction
89902ec4f68b0034cd4410d9eadec2321da113aecdf0f8454af053f5f8bf7140
spent
true